Fascia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Fascia repair services focus on restoring the structural and aesthetic integrity of the fascia boards that run along the edges of a building’s roof. These boards serve as a key component in protecting the roof and attic from water infiltration and help maintain the overall appearance of a home. Projects typically involve replacing or repairing damaged, rotted, or decayed fascia due to weather exposure, pests, or age. Homeowners often seek fascia repairs when noticing issues such as sagging, mold, peeling paint, or water stains near the roofline, which can indicate underlying damage that needs attention.
Before requesting fascia repair, property owners should consider the extent of the damage and whether it affects other parts of the roofing system, such as soffits or gutters. It’s important to identify if the fascia is simply surface-level damaged or if it has compromised the underlying structure. Proper assessment can ensure that repairs address the root cause of the problem and prevent future issues. Understanding the scope of work and materials involved can help homeowners make informed decisions about maintaining the safety and appearance of their property.

Common Fascia Repair Jobs
Fascia Repair - Restores damaged or rotted fascia boards to protect the roof and structure.
Fascia Replacement - Replaces deteriorated or broken fascia to improve curb appeal and prevent water intrusion.
Fascia Reinforcement - Strengthens existing fascia to support gutters and resist weather-related stress.
Fascia Sealing - Seals gaps and cracks in fascia to prevent moisture damage and pest entry.
Fascia Inspection - Assesses fascia condition to identify issues early and plan necessary repairs.
Fascia Maintenance - Provides ongoing upkeep to extend the lifespan of fascia components.
Fascia Repair Questions
What is fascia repair? Fascia repair involves fixing damaged or rotted fascia boards that run along the roofline of a property, helping to protect the roof and improve curb appeal.
When should fascia be repaired or replaced? Fascia should be repaired or replaced when signs of rot, mold, or water damage are visible, or if the boards are cracked or warped.
What types of projects typically require fascia repair? Common projects include addressing water leaks, replacing damaged fascia boards, or preparing a property for new siding or roofing installations.
Why is fascia repair important for property maintenance? Proper fascia repair helps prevent water damage, pest intrusion, and structural issues, maintaining the overall integrity of the property.
